Analysis of Factors Affecting Forest Fire Vulnerability in Central Yunnan Based on VSD Model

Abstract:In order to accurately measure the risk of forest fire,the concept of forest fire vulnerability was proposed based on VSD model,and the influencing factors of forest fire vulnerability were analyzed.The nine evaluation indexes,such as forest coverage rate and local fiscal revenue,were selected to construct the evaluation index system of forest fire vulnerability in central Yunnan based on the analysis of exposure,sensitivity and adaptability.Combined with the analytic hierarchy process and the weighted comprehensive evaluation method,the vulnerability of forest fire in central Yunnan from 2008 to 2017 was evaluated.The result showed that the index weights were ranked as annual precipitation(0.223)>local fiscal revenue(0.177)>annual average temperature(0.123)>forestry output value(0.107)>per capita net income of farmers(0.097)>population density(0.085)>forest coverage rate(0.067)=proportion of urban population(0.067)>per capita GDP(0.054).The forest fire vulnerability index values of cities in central Yunnan were strongly correlated with the frequency of forest fires,moderately correlated with the affected forest area and disaster rate,which could accurately reflect the status of forest fire risk.
